What is this form?

The Organizational Minutes for an Oklahoma Professional Corporation is a legal document that records the actions taken during the creation of a professional corporation in Oklahoma. This form is essential for establishing critical corporate governance matters, such as the election of officers and directors, the issuance of stock, and the approval of corporate bylaws. Unlike other corporate documents, this form serves to formally document these initial decisions, ensuring compliance with Oklahoma law and providing a clear record for future reference.

What’s included in this form

  • Name of the corporation and par value of shares.
  • Details of shareholders and shares owned.
  • Identities of directors and their qualifications.
  • Election results for corporate officers such as President and Secretary.
  • Approval of the articles of incorporation and bylaws.
  • Consent to actions by incorporators, shareholders, and directors.

When this form is needed

This form should be used during the initial organizational phase of a professional corporation in Oklahoma. It is necessary to document key decisions made by incorporators, directors, and shareholders following the filing of the articles of incorporation. Use this form to legitimize the establishment of your corporation, coordinate the election of officers, and outline the procedural steps taken in compliance with state law.

Completing this form step by step

  • Identify and enter the name of your corporation and set the par value of the shares.
  • List all shareholders along with the number of shares they own and the consideration paid.
  • Provide the names and addresses of directors, ensuring each is licensed in Oklahoma.
  • Document the election of officers, including the President and Secretary, with their licenses verified.
  • Record the date the articles were filed and include signatures from incorporators, shareholders, and directors.

Notarization requirements for this form

This form does not typically require notarization unless specified by local law. However, always ensure that all parties review and sign the document to uphold its legal validity.

Avoid these common issues

  • Failing to verify that all directors and officers are licensed to practice in Oklahoma.
  • Not documenting the par value of shares correctly, which can cause compliance issues.
  • Neglecting to obtain necessary signatures from all involved parties.
  • Forgetting to specify the bank account details for corporate funds.

Unlike corporations, limited liability companies (LLCs) are not required by state law to hold meetings or record minutes of the meetings they do hold. Though they are not required by law, it is helpful for LLCs to keep minutes to help protect their business.

To form a corporation in Oklahoma, you must file a certificate of incorporation with the Secretary of State and pay a filing fee. The corporation's existence begins when you file the certificate.
